Professor Kidd said Australia had strong disease controls in place, with high testing numbers, swift contact tracing and mandatory hotel quarantine for returning overseas travellers.
In response to the emergence of new variants overseas, whole genome sequencing on all positive cases in Australia has been prioritised, he said. This allows rapid identification of those infected with a VOC and enables these cases to be managed with additional precautions to mitigate risk to the public.
